Abstract

The invention relates to an environment-friendly and anti-counterfeiting laser printing technique, which pertains to the field of laser printing. The main point of the invention is that a plain paper is adopted by the technique, when in use, firstly an information layer of pictures and words is directly and continuously printed on the plain paper by a flexographic plate; then a bright layer is printed on the information layer of pictures and words by the flexographic plate, at the same time a laser layer of pictures and words is pressed on the bright layer by a film; the bright layer and the laser layer of pictures and words are solidified; finally with the continuous solidification of the bright layer and the laser layer of pictures and words, pressed films are continuously and immediately peeled off from the paper by a peeling device. The environment-friendly and anti-counterfeiting laser printing technique of the invention has an optimization and improvement on the existing technical process and has the advantages that by adopting the laser printing technique of the invention, printing can be directly processed on the plain paper, industrialized and continuous printing can be realized, and the product printed by the invention can present the effect of node laser. Furthermore, the laser printing technique of the invention is far superior to the products of the prior art in the aspects of practicability, environmental friendliness and economical efficiency.

The specific embodiment
This technology is all kinds of common white paperboards with the printing usefulness of 80g-400g as shown in Figure 1, grey board, art paper etc. are as stock 1, stock 1 at first directly carries out the printing of graph text information and security pattern by environmental printing unit 2, carry out the printing of light layer through environmental protection light layer printing element 3 then, in 3 printings of light layer printing element, forme can be done the graph text information of hollow out, make that the graph text information that prints out is hidden, through mould unit 4 the laser holographic security pattern is loaded on the light layer again, stock 1 is through drying unit 5 subsequently, light layer and the laser holographic security pattern of mould at stock 1 solidified, curing along with light layer and laser graphic layer, instant by stripping machine 6 at last, the continuous press mold with on light layer and the laser graphic layer peels off, and promptly obtains environmental protection, false proof, the exquisite final products with laser effect 7.
As shown in Figure 2, graph text information layer 8 that presents on the stock 1 and laser holographic picture and text layer 9 structural representation.
Laser graphic Information Level 9 among this figure, it is the surface that laser holographic pattern, Word message is loaded into stock 1 and graph text information layer 8 by the mode of mould, and the hiding graph text information that also has hollow out in the laser holographic picture and text layer 9, thus by the laser holographic pattern and hollow out hides Info and the printing figure message layer in the multiple scheme of anti-counterfeit printing false proof in conjunction with carrying out.
Environmental printing unit 2, light layer printing element 3 are all selected flexographic printing for use.
The light layer of flexographic printing can adopt two kinds of gloss varnish.The main feature of this two classes gloss varnish is to solidify its surface, back to form crystallizing layer, thus with film can not produce bonding securely, more a little under the external force film just can come off.Its main component is a kind of to be water, resin, light pigment and other auxiliary materials, and another kind is alcohol, light curing agent, light pigment and other auxiliary materials.The composition of two kinds of gloss varnish is the material of environment-friendly type, can not produce any harm to environment and human body.These two kinds of gloss varnish all have commercially available, are prior art products.The curing of light layer is according to the difference of component, can adopt infrared ray cured, or ultraviolet curing, curing rate is 150m/min.
Described technology is by many equipment on line realization productions continuously successively of coupling mutually.
Mould unit and stripping machine 6 are a whole set of linkage, stripping machine 6 can be realized continuous production for equipment, prior art has been made adaptive improvement, mainly add film guiding roller, dance roller, press bonding roller, stripper roll, film collecting roller, the position of each roller can be according to the demand of practical production adjustment, a whole set of transmission device is linked to printing equipment, is guaranteeing and is printing the differential tension that can come balance film and paper on the synchronous basis by electromagnetic braking.
